Wuxiaworld-2-eBook

This Python script will download chapters from novels availaible on wuxiaworld.com and saves them into the .epub format.

Getting Started

To run this script you'll need to have Python 3.6.x installed which you can find here.

Features

Prerequisites

As mentioned before this script was written for Python version 3.6.x. It may work with other versions too but none are tested. Additionally the Python image library (Pillow), lxml and Beautifulsoup4 are required. To install all dependencies just use the console to navigate into the project folder and write

pip install -r requirements.txt

Usage

Download the script and navigate to the folder using the console then write

python wuxiaworld2ebook.py

or just use the start.bat file. If you didn't add Python to the PATH variable during the installation or afterwards the write

path/where/you/installed/python.exe wuxiaworld2ebook.py

After that just select the novel you want to read, enter the chapter range you want to include to the eBook, enter the book number of the novel you want to read (if applicable) and hit the "Generate" Button. Keep it mind that it will take some time for the script to finish, so don't close the window or the console if the program doesn't respond.

For Mac Users

You'll likely experience SSL Certificate problems. Please check Issue #35 for a way to resolve this bug.
